A Season of Saints: Cloud of Witnesses
Sermon preached on 2019-11-03 by Rev. Sarah Harrison-McQueen. Worship series, "A Season of Saints." Sermon, "Cloud of Witnesses." Hebrews 11:1-2, 11:32-12:2
Hebrews 11-12
By faith, by faith, by faith… the long line of forefathers and foremothers unfolds in this passage, declaring God’s powerful deeds done by means of their faith. If the author of Hebrews wrote this passage today who else might be named? Would it include people like Martin Luther King, Jr. or Mother Teresa? Would it also include people who carried the faith to you? Parents, siblings, and friends who walked with you by faith through a challenging time. Aunties who disclosed God’s marvelous works in their lives and cousins who held your hand in hushed prayers under the night’s sky. How many thousands of pages would be filled if we listed all of the names of ordinary people who lived by great faith? This great cloud of witnesses, the ones we personally know and the ones whom we’ve only read about, are cheering us on. One day we too will be part of this cloud of witnesses.
- How are you now carrying faith to others?
- How can you be the one who tells others of the glory of God, the relative who holds out a hand in prayer, or that friend who walks by faith alongside another?
- Who is in your great cloud of witnesses?
- What are the feats of faith that you’ve seen in your own life?
